Transaction 255a4076173cd7fab15b14e49be049ed66ae9e7f42f4654789c540fb912705d3

1 Input
1 Outputs
  • 255a4076173cd7fab15b14e49be049ed66ae9e7f42f4654789c540fb912705d3:0
  • value  164097
    address  3KjwgjjxBDk7Z53bWAGgL5Vajz3PpGw4Zx